Role Purpose

This is a varied role which encompasses several primary elements; site team supervision, customer relationship management, technical and operational project delivery, and safety management. The majority of your time will be spent out on project sites in your assigned region.

The Contracts Supervisor supports the Contracts Manager with the day to day oversight and delivery of temporary site services. This role is key to ensuring service consistency and standards implementation. You will interact regularly with our customers and help us to maintain our excellent reputation and as we deliver upon the promise of our brand.

In terms of project delivery, you will be expected to improve our engineering abilities, overall site productivity and installation quality whilst reducing operational cost without compromising safety.

Safety and service reliability are the principles upon which the company was founded. These core values must always be maintained and, where identified, improved to meet changing client, cultural and legislative expectations.

Main Responsibilities And Accountabilities Of The Role

  • Ensure that the expected standards are maintained by our site personnel; in particular site productivity, uniform, safety, time keeping and paperwork
  • Visit sites to put teams to work and sign off / snag work upon completion
  • Visit sites to gather information for variation works to be priced by the Contracts Managers
  • Coordinate with the customer work start dates and work scopes to be completed
  • Assist with the development and training of site team personnel
  • Work with team engineers to improve our project engineering abilities
  • Foster and improve upon our strong safety culture, review site risk assessments and method statements (RAMS) and ensure teams understand and comply with
  • Contribute to the ongoing development of departmental processes and procedures to improve efficiency and continue to meet the changing business’ needs.

Essential Skills and Experience

  • 5 + years’ experience as a Senior Electrician
  • Proven supervisory ability within the construction and allied industries
  • Strong communication and team building skills
  • A thorough understanding of industry health and safety issues
  • Full driving license

Preferred

  • Temporary electrical sector experience
  • Mechanical qualification / experience
  • Appropriate health and safety qualification SSSTS / SMSTS / NEBOSH
  • Past involvement of staff training
  • Construction industry contacts
